My best friend has a M700, It is a great gun. He has killed deer, elk, and antelope.



That price isn't bad. But if it were me I would wait and look for a stainless version. There is a lot of nooks and crannies that can trap powder and cause rust. If you can inspect it in person. Take it apart and really look at it close. 125.00 isn't a bad price. But I have seen stainless versions sell for 250 to 300. I would hold out for the stainless.
